About Port of Grise Fiord
Grise Fiord is Canada's northernmost public community, located on Ellesmere Island. It serves as a vital supply point for this remote Arctic hamlet. Historically, general cargo, passenger, and tanker vessels have called at the port.
Background
Grise Fiord is an Inuit hamlet on the southern tip of Ellesmere Island, in the Qikiqtaaluk Region, Nunavut, Canada. It is one of three populated places on the island; despite its low population, it is the largest community on Ellesmere Island. Created by the Canadian Government in 1953 through a relocation of Inuit families from Inukjuak, Quebec, it is Canada's northernmost public community. It is also one of the coldest inhabited places in the world, with an average yearly temperature of −16.5 °C (2.3 °F).Current Conditions
